2017蜘蛛池源码是一款免费开源的互联网数据采集工具,旨在帮助用户轻松获取网站数据。该程序通过模拟浏览器行为,自动化地访问目标网站并提取所需信息,支持多种数据格式输出,如JSON、XML等。该源码不仅适用于个人用户,也适用于企业用户进行大规模数据采集和数据分析。通过探索这款源码,用户可以深入了解互联网数据采集的奥秘,并应用于各种场景中,如搜索引擎优化、竞品分析、市场研究等。
在2017年,互联网技术的飞速发展不仅改变了人们的生活方式,也极大地推动了数据获取与分析技术的进步,在这一背景下,“蜘蛛池”作为一种高效、自动化的网络爬虫工具,成为了众多企业和个人获取互联网数据的重要工具,本文将深入探讨2017年流行的“蜘蛛池”源码,解析其工作原理、技术特点以及在实际应用中的价值。
什么是“蜘蛛池”
“蜘蛛池”本质上是一个集合了多个网络爬虫(即“网络爬虫”或“网络蜘蛛”)的平台,用户可以通过这个平台快速部署和管理多个爬虫,实现大规模、高效率的数据采集,与传统的单一爬虫相比,蜘蛛池具有更高的灵活性、可扩展性和效率,能够应对更加复杂多变的网络环境。
2017年蜘蛛池源码的技术特点
1、分布式架构:2017年的蜘蛛池源码普遍采用了分布式架构设计,使得爬虫可以分布式运行,大大提高了数据采集的效率和规模。
2、模块化设计:源码采用了模块化的设计思想,将爬虫的不同功能模块(如URL管理、数据解析、存储等)进行拆分,使得每个模块可以独立开发和维护,提高了系统的可维护性和可扩展性。
3、高效的数据解析:为了应对复杂的网页结构,蜘蛛池源码通常集成了多种数据解析算法,如正则表达式、XPath、CSS选择器等,能够高效准确地提取网页中的数据。
4、智能防反爬机制:为了应对网站的防爬策略,蜘蛛池源码通常内置了智能防反爬机制,如设置请求间隔、模拟用户行为、使用代理IP等,有效降低了被目标网站封禁的风险。
5、强大的数据存储能力:蜘蛛池源码支持多种数据存储方式,如关系型数据库、NoSQL数据库、文件存储等,能够满足不同场景下的数据存储需求。
蜘蛛池的实际应用
1、市场研究:企业可以利用蜘蛛池定期采集竞争对手的产品信息、价格信息、市场趋势等,为市场分析和决策提供有力支持。
2、舆情监控:政府机构和企业可以通过蜘蛛池实时采集社交媒体、论坛、新闻网站等平台的舆情信息,及时把握舆论动态,有效应对负面舆情。
3、数据挖掘与分析:学术研究机构可以利用蜘蛛池采集大量公开数据,进行数据挖掘和分析,发现数据背后的规律和趋势,为科学研究提供有力支持。
4、内容聚合创作者可以利用蜘蛛池采集相关领域的优质内容,进行内容聚合和二次创作,提高内容生产的效率和质量。
蜘蛛池源码的维护与升级
随着网络环境的不断变化和网站防爬策略的不断升级,蜘蛛池源码也需要不断维护和升级以适应新的需求,这包括:
1、更新防反爬策略:定期更新防反爬策略,以应对新的反爬手段。
2、优化性能:根据实际应用场景优化爬虫的性能,提高数据采集的效率和稳定性。
3、增强安全性:加强系统的安全性,防止数据泄露和非法访问。
4、扩展新功能:根据用户需求不断扩展新功能,提高系统的灵活性和可扩展性。
面临的挑战与未来展望
尽管蜘蛛池在数据采集和分析方面有着广泛的应用和巨大的潜力,但也面临着一些挑战和限制,随着隐私保护法规的加强和网站安全措施的升级,爬虫在数据采集过程中可能会面临更多的法律和安全风险,随着人工智能和机器学习技术的发展,未来的数据采集和分析可能会更加智能化和自动化,开发者需要不断关注新技术的发展和应用场景的变化,持续更新和优化蜘蛛池源码以适应新的需求。
2017年的蜘蛛池源码作为互联网数据采集的重要工具之一,在分布式架构、模块化设计、高效数据解析等方面取得了显著进展,通过实际应用案例可以看出其在市场研究、舆情监控、数据挖掘与分析等方面具有广泛的应用价值,然而随着网络环境的不断变化和法规政策的加强未来开发者需要不断关注新技术的发展和应用场景的变化持续更新和优化蜘蛛池源码以适应新的需求,同时我们也需要关注爬虫技术的伦理和法律问题确保其在合法合规的框架内运行和发展。